Article Abstract

Through a MassQL-integrated strategy, 26 vibsane diterpenoids (VibDs) were identified from , including 15 new compounds () and 11 known analogues (). Compound possessed an unprecedented seven-membered ring scaffold, representing a new type of VibD. The hypothetical biosynthetic pathway of was proposed. Notably, could exert the antihepatoma effect by targeting MAPKAPK2, thereby suppressing its kinase activity and subsequent phosphorylation of HSP27 and .
